# 鬓 bìn
temple hair

## Meaning
Today, 鬓 still primarily refers to the hair on the sides of the face near the ears, often used to describe sideburns or temple hair.
## History
The character 鬓 (bìn) is a phono-semantic compound character. The semantic component 髟 (biāo) indicates hair, as it resembles a person with long hair. The phonetic component 賓 (bīn) suggests the pronunciation and also carries the meaning of an attendant or companion, which implies assistance or being close to someone. This combination indicates that 鬓 refers to the hair on the sides of the face near the ears.
The original meaning of 鬓 is sideburns or the hair on the temples.
